We are an express wash so our equipment actually washes the cars. ~80% of the time we’re inside talking to guests at our cashier window, watching cars in the wash to ensure a safe and problem-free experience, and cleaning inside the car wash, which does include getting wet here and there. When outside we are keeping the self vacuum area clean and assisting guests as needed. It is much more of a customer service role.
